Shares of Zicom Electronic Security Systems surged over 5 per cent today after the Railway Budget proposed CCTV surveillance at all stations.
The stock climbed 5.39 per cent to settle at Rs 73.30 on BSE. During the day, it surged 9.99 per cent to Rs 76.50.
At NSE, shares of the company went up by 5 per cent to end at Rs 73.25.
On the volume front, 1.40 lakh shares of the company changed hands at BSE and over 4 lakh shares were traded at NSE during the day.
Railway Budget 2016-17 proposed CCTV surveillance for all stations, while 300 major stations will be covered this year.
Zicom provides electronic security products, including CCTVs.
Meanwhile, the BSE benchmark Sensex ended at 22,976, down 112.93 points.
